Breeders really make sacrifices for the breed, their dogs aren't pets they are working dogs, and will have a whole set of problems that pet owners don't face. Also, we do have a serious pet problem in this country and thousands of dogs are put to death each year because there aren’t enough homes. The only dogs that should be bred are those who have passed a series of tests, health and confirmation tests. Also, breeding is no easy thing, just because your dog is an excellent example of the breed, you need to be able to predict how his offspring will look when mated with some female, and this of course means, knowing how to read pedigrees.
